Removing Titles from “Continue Watching” on the Web
The web interface offers the most granular control over your “Continue Watching” list. This method allows you to remove individual titles directly from your viewing history.
Step-by-Step Instructions
- Log into your Netflix account on a web browser (desktop or mobile).
- Hover over your profile icon in the top right corner and select “Account”.
- Scroll down to the “Profile & Parental Controls” section.
- Choose the profile you want to edit (e.g., “John’s Profile”).
- Click on “Viewing Activity”. This will display a chronological list of everything you’ve watched on that profile.
- Locate the movie or show you want to remove.
- Click the “Hide from Viewing History” icon (a circle with a line through it) next to the title.
- Confirm your selection. The title will be removed almost immediately.
- Optionally, if you want to hide all of your viewing history, you can click the “Hide All” button at the bottom of the page.
Important Considerations
- Refresh is Key: It might take a few minutes for the change to reflect on all your devices. Try refreshing your Netflix app or browser.
- Profile Specific: This process must be repeated for each profile on your account.
- Permanent Removal: Removing a title from your viewing activity completely deletes it from the “Continue Watching” row.
Removing Titles on Mobile Devices (Android & iOS)
While the mobile apps don’t offer direct viewing history editing, you can still access the web version through your mobile browser.
Step-by-Step Instructions (Mobile Browser)
- Open your mobile browser (Chrome, Safari, etc.).
- Navigate to the Netflix website and log in to your account.
- Follow the same steps as outlined in the “Removing Titles from ‘Continue Watching’ on the Web” section.
Limitation
The mobile app itself does not provide the functionality to directly edit the “Viewing Activity”. You must use a mobile browser.
Removing Titles on Smart TVs and Streaming Devices
Similar to mobile devices, Smart TVs and streaming devices like Roku and Apple TV generally don’t offer direct viewing history editing within the Netflix app.
Utilizing the Web Interface
The best approach is to use a computer or mobile device to access the Netflix website and remove titles as described in the “Removing Titles from ‘Continue Watching’ on the Web” section. The changes will then sync to your TV.
Force-Quitting the App
After making changes via the web interface, force-quitting and restarting the Netflix app on your Smart TV or streaming device can help expedite the update.

FAQ 1: How long does it take for a removed title to disappear from the “Continue Watching” row?
Generally, the change is almost instantaneous. However, allow a few minutes, and try refreshing the Netflix app or website. Persistent issues often stem from caching, so clearing your browser’s cache or force-quitting the app can help.
FAQ 2: Can I remove an entire profile’s viewing history at once?
Yes, on the “Viewing Activity” page, there is a “Hide All” button at the bottom. Clicking this will remove all titles from your viewing history. Be aware that this is a permanent action and cannot be undone.
FAQ 3: Does removing a title from “Continue Watching” affect my Netflix recommendations?
Yes, removing titles from your viewing history can influence your Netflix recommendations. The algorithm uses your viewing data to suggest content, so removing something implies you’re not interested in similar shows or movies.
FAQ 4: Can I stop Netflix from adding titles to my “Continue Watching” row in the first place?
Unfortunately, there’s no direct setting to prevent titles from appearing in the “Continue Watching” row if you start watching them. However, you can minimize unwanted additions by being selective about what you start watching, and promptly removing titles you aren’t enjoying.
FAQ 5: If I delete my profile, will that remove the “Continue Watching” titles?
Yes, deleting a profile will erase all its associated viewing data, including the “Continue Watching” list. However, deleting a profile is a drastic measure and will also remove any watchlists, ratings, and other personalized settings associated with that profile.
FAQ 6: Is there a way to “pause” a movie without it going into “Continue Watching”?
While not a perfect solution, you could avoid hitting “play” and instead scroll through the episodes or scenes before starting the movie. However, once you initiate playback, even for a short period, it will likely be added to “Continue Watching”.
FAQ 7: Can I use parental controls to limit what appears in the “Continue Watching” row for a child’s profile?
Parental controls allow you to restrict the types of content a profile can access, but they don’t directly affect the “Continue Watching” row. If a child starts watching a restricted title, it will still appear in their “Continue Watching” until manually removed. The best approach is to regularly review the viewing activity on children’s profiles.
FAQ 8: How do I clear my viewing history if I’m using someone else’s Netflix account?
You should ask the account owner to remove the titles from the “Viewing Activity” associated with your profile. Accessing and modifying someone else’s account without permission is generally considered a breach of trust.
FAQ 9: Will removing a title from “Continue Watching” also remove it from my Netflix queue/watchlist?
No, removing a title from “Continue Watching” only affects that specific row. It does not remove it from your “My List” (watchlist). These are separate features.
FAQ 10: Are there any third-party apps or extensions that can help me manage my Netflix viewing history?
While some third-party tools might exist, exercise caution when using them. Sharing your Netflix login credentials with unverified apps or extensions can compromise your account security. Netflix officially recommends using the built-in tools.
FAQ 11: What happens if I accidentally remove a title from my viewing history that I wanted to keep?
Unfortunately, there’s no “undo” button. You’ll need to search for the title again and begin watching it to re-add it to your “Continue Watching” row. Pay close attention when removing titles to avoid accidental deletions.
FAQ 12: How does Netflix determine the order of movies in the “Continue Watching” row?
Netflix generally orders the titles in the “Continue Watching” row based on the most recently viewed. The title you last watched will typically appear at the beginning of the row.
